So anyways, this is the Parade of the Stars. This was the first parade I've ever seen at Disney :heart: This was the parade for Disneyland's 45th anniversary (I have some merchandise for the star-themed anniversary but I have no idea where they are) :(

This parade was around the time Fantasia 2000 came out, so the entire parade was Fantasia themed. I love this parade since I grew up with it, & even though Max was is in it, I thought this parade could've been better. The floats were AMAZING, and the Fantasia aspect was incredible, but I have a problem with the music. They used the same song throughout the entire parade, and I thought it was too chill. I mean, now I feel like it's too chill, when I was a kid, I obviously didn't care :XD:

The parades we've had after this: The Parade of Dreams & The Soundsational Parade, had music that got you pumped and you could dance to. & each float had it's own music. This parade didn't have that. Then again, & I didn't realize this until I watched it on youtube, this was supposed to be a Movie Premiere theme, hence the name "The Parade of the Stars."

The song they played for this parade was "When You Wished Upon a Star," but it sounded like Hollywood music, if that makes sense. Watch this parade on Youtube, you'll get what I mean! :XD:

Again, I really love the Fantasia aspect of it. Most of the dancers in front of the floats were characters from Fantasia: The hippos with tutu's, & the mushrooms. I really like it because Fantasia is kind of an obscure Disney movie. The parades we have now, only seem to have floats for popular Disney movies. For instance, every single parade I've seen at Disneyland has ALWAYS had a Lion King float, a Little Mermaid float & a Beauty & The Beast float. I love those movies, but I wish they'd shake it up a bit. I love how the Soundsational Parade has a float for "The Three Cabelleros." It shows that some Disney movies were never forgotten!!
